c语言基本输出函数printf()详解164
C语言中,printf() 函数是用于打印数据的标准输出函数。它是一个非常强大的函数,可以打印各种数据类型,并且可以控制输出格式。
函数原型int printf(const char *format, ...);
* format: 指定输出格式的字符串。
* ...: 可变参数列表,包含要打印的实际数据。
格式字符串格式字符串由以下部分组成:
* 普通文本:直接输出。
* 格式说明符:以 % 开头,指定要输出的数据类型和格式。
格式说明符* %c:字符。
* %d:十进制整型。
* %f:浮点型。
* %s:字符串。
* %p:指针。
格式修饰符格式修饰符用于控制输出的宽度、填充字符和对齐方式。它们放在格式说明符之前。
* 宽度:指定输出字段的宽度。可以用整数或星号(*)表示(从可变参数列表中获取)。
* 填充字符:指定用于填充输出字段的字符。默认为空格。
* 对齐方式:指定输出字段的对齐方式。可以是 -(左对齐)、+(显示正负号)、0(右对齐)。
示例以下是一些 printf() 函数的示例:
printf("Hello, world!");
printf("Number: %d", 10);
printf("Float: %f", 3.14);
printf("String: %s", "This is a string");
返回值printf() 函数返回打印的字符数,如果不成功则返回负值。
其他输出函数除了 printf() 函数外,C语言还提供了其他输出函数:
* fprintf():将数据输出到文件或流。
* sprintf():将数据格式化为字符串。
* vprintf():类似于 printf(),但可变参数列表在函数参数中显式指定。
printf() 函数是 C语言中用于打印数据的基本输出函数。它是一个功能强大的函数,可以打印各种数据类型并控制输出格式。通过理解格式字符串、格式修饰符和返回值,您可以有效地使用 printf() 函数进行数据输出。
2024-11-06
上一篇:C 语言除法输出趣谈
下一篇:用 C 语言探索指数函数
Python调用C/C++共享库深度解析:从ctypes到Python扩展模块
https://www.shuihudhg.cn/134263.html
深入理解与实践:Python在SAR图像去噪中的Lee滤波技术
https://www.shuihudhg.cn/134262.html
Java方法重载完全指南:提升代码可读性、灵活性与可维护性
https://www.shuihudhg.cn/134261.html
Python数据可视化利器:玩转各类“纵横图”代码实践
https://www.shuihudhg.cn/134260.html
C语言等式输出:从基础`printf`到高级动态与格式化技巧
https://www.shuihudhg.cn/134259.html
热门文章
C 语言中实现正序输出
https://www.shuihudhg.cn/2788.html
c语言选择排序算法详解
https://www.shuihudhg.cn/45804.html
C 语言函数:定义与声明
https://www.shuihudhg.cn/5703.html
C语言中的开方函数:sqrt()
https://www.shuihudhg.cn/347.html
C 语言中字符串输出的全面指南
https://www.shuihudhg.cn/4366.html